Do not save OG for the later use. Do both the og12 and verbal OG, and if you still feel you have more time for practice then do LSAT CR. Near you exam revise OG's again.

Doing official material multiple time is far better than practicing other prep material. For verbal, official material is always better than that of any other prep company.

Powerscore is excellent and geared towards GMAT. But you can purchase their LSAT LR books which just have additional and extra hard problems. But I wouldn't recommend it. Get Powerscore CR and use their strategies to practice on problems from OG and other books.
